The "BUSY" indicator is similar to the noise-activated squelch on
an FM rig.?? It doesn't actually detect specific tones in the
passband as an indication of "signal present".? Rather, it looks
at the total noise power in the passband.? When the noise power
drops due to a signal being present, the channel is considered
"BUSY".?? Tuning a notch filter into the passband also decreases
the amount of noise in the passband and "fools" the program into
thinking the channel is "BUSY".
